服务器容灾备份,如何确保业务连续性和数据安全?
服务器容灾备份是确保业务连续性和数据安全性的重要措施,在现代信息系统中扮演着至关重要的角色,以下是对服务器容灾备份的详细回答:
一、容灾备份策略
1、定期备份:定期进行本地备份,以确保数据可以在短期内快速恢复,这种备份方式适用于日常的数据保护,可以防止因人为错误或系统故障导致的数据丢失。
2、跨地域备份:将数据复制到地理位置分散的远程服务器上,以防单点故障,这种方式可以应对自然灾害等导致的主站点损毁,确保数据的高可用性和完整性。
3、镜像备份:为云服务器创建一个系统盘的镜像,当系统出现问题时,可以快速恢复系统盘的数据,这种方式适用于需要快速恢复整个系统的场景。
4、快照备份:基于时间点的备份方法,为云服务器创建一个或多个时间点的数据副本,这种方式可以保留数据的历史版本,便于在需要时恢复到特定的时间点。
二、备份工具
1、云服务商提供的备份工具:如MySQL的mysqldump命令、SQL Server的sqlcmd命令等,这些工具通常与云服务商的数据库服务紧密集成,使用方便。
2、第三方备份工具:如Bacula、Veeam等开源或商业备份软件,这些工具提供了更丰富的功能和更高的灵活性,适用于各种复杂的备份需求。
三、数据验证
定期检查和验证备份数据,确保备份数据的完整性、一致性和可恢复性,这是容灾备份策略中不可或缺的一环,只有经过验证的备份数据才能在需要时发挥应有的作用。
四、故障转移方案
1、故障转移配置:主动-主动配置和主动-被动(备用)配置是两种常见的故障转移配置方式,主动-主动配置中,多个节点同时运行,分担工作量;而主动-被动配置中,包括多个节点,但并非所有节点都同时处于活动状态,一旦主动节点停止工作,被动节点就会被激活并充当故障转移节点。
2、故障转移流程:故障转移流程通常被设计为自动触发,一旦检测到系统异常,备用服务器将立即接管服务,在发生故障转移时,确保所有数据的副本保持一致,以避免数据冲突和服务中断。
五、系统架构与硬件配置
1、系统架构:采用多层分布式设计,包括主服务器集群、热备服务器集群以及远程备份服务器集群,主服务器集群负责处理正常业务,热备服务器集群在主服务器集群出现故障时立即接管服务,远程备份服务器集群用于跨地域备份。
2、硬件配置:高性能的处理器、冗余电源供应和多个网络接口卡(NIC)是确保高可用性和容错能力的关键,冗余设计确保关键组件的故障不会导致系统停机。
六、监控与报警机制
1、故障检测:利用先进的监控系统来识别异常行为和性能下降,以便及时发现潜在的问题。
2、告警通知流程:确保一旦检测到问题,相关人员和系统管理员能够立即收到通知,以便及时采取措施进行处理。
七、应急响应与恢复计划
1、应急响应计划:确定数据恢复的优先级、责任人和流程,准备必要的恢复工具和资源。
2、恢复演练:定期执行模拟故障转移演练,以验证自动故障转移流程的正确性和及时性,通过演练可以发现潜在的问题并进行改进。
八、相关问答FAQs
1、什么是RTO和RPO?
RTO(Recovery Time Objective)是指将系统恢复到正常运行状态所需的最大时间,目标是将RTO减少到最短,理想情况下是在几分钟内。
RPO(Recovery Point Objective)是指灾难发生时可以接受的数据丢失量,目标是将RPO设置为零,实施连续数据保护(CDP)策略。
2、两地三中心是什么?它与同城双活有什么区别?
两地三中心是指在两个地方建立三个数据中心:生产中心、同城容灾中心和异地容灾中心,同城双中心是指在同城或邻近城市建立两个可独立承担关键系统运行的数据中心,两者的主要区别在于两地三中心多了一个异地数据中心,用于规避大自然灾害带来的风险。
九、小编有话说
随着业务的不断发展和技术的进步,企业对于服务器容灾备份的需求越来越高,一个完善的容灾备份方案不仅能够保障业务连续性和数据安全性,还能够降低由于系统不稳定导致的潜在经济损失,企业应该根据自身的业务需求和技术实力制定合适的容灾备份策略,并定期进行审查和更新以适应新的业务需求和技术变化,加强员工对于容灾备份知识的培训也是提高整体应对能力的重要一环。
原创文章,作者:未希,如若转载,请注明出处:https://www.lbseo.cn/13416.html